WebJan 4, 2024 · Flint’s water had a pH of 8 in December 2014 and then dropped to 7.3 by August 2015. This is not in the optimum range for preventing corrosion of lead pipes. Boston, a city with an abundance of lead pipes, had an average water pH of about 9.6 in 2015. Adding a chemical called orthophosphate to the water.
